The absence of the input panel on Android devices, despite user interaction with text fields, represents a common operational disruption. This unexpected disappearance prevents text entry in applications, affecting communication, data input, and overall device usability. For example, an individual attempting to compose an email might find themselves unable to type as the expected virtual keyboard does not appear after tapping the message body field.
The reliable functionality of the on-screen typing interface is critical for modern mobile device interaction. Its absence can impede productivity and accessibility, potentially causing user frustration. Historically, such issues have been linked to software glitches, system conflicts, or unintended modifications to device settings. Recognizing and addressing the underlying causes ensures seamless device operation.
Understanding the root causes and implementing appropriate troubleshooting steps are essential for resolving this issue. The following sections will delve into potential causes, diagnostic procedures, and practical solutions designed to restore expected typing functionality.
1. App Compatibility
App compatibility represents a significant factor contributing to instances where the on-screen typing interface fails to appear on Android devices. Certain applications may not be fully optimized for all virtual keyboard implementations or may contain code that conflicts with the system’s input method manager. This incompatibility can prevent the keyboard from loading when the user attempts to input text within the problematic application. For example, an older application relying on outdated SDKs might not properly interface with newer keyboard applications designed for more recent Android operating system versions. This often manifests as a complete absence of the keyboard within that specific application while the keyboard functions correctly in other contexts.
The root cause of application incompatibility can vary. It may stem from the application developer’s neglect to update their software to align with current Android API levels and keyboard functionalities. In other scenarios, custom text fields or unique UI elements implemented within the app might inadvertently interfere with the keyboard’s rendering process. Diagnostic approaches involve testing alternative keyboard applications to ascertain whether the issue is isolated to a specific keyboard or persistent across different input methods. If the problem remains confined to the particular application, it strongly suggests an underlying compatibility issue.
Ultimately, resolving app compatibility problems may necessitate contacting the application developer for updates or revisions that address the conflict. In the interim, users might explore using alternative applications with similar functionalities or consider reporting the incompatibility to both the application developer and the keyboard application provider. Addressing application compatibility is crucial for ensuring a consistent and reliable user experience across various Android applications.
2. Keyboard App Enabled
The operational status of the selected keyboard application is a foundational element influencing its visibility on Android. If the designated keyboard application is disabled, the expected on-screen input panel will not appear, irrespective of other system configurations. This scenario represents a direct cause-and-effect relationship: a disabled keyboard application prevents the system from initiating its input functionality. The “Keyboard App Enabled” component, therefore, becomes a critical prerequisite for proper input operation. For instance, a user might inadvertently disable their preferred keyboard application within the Android settings, leading to an apparent failure of the typing interface to load across all applications requiring text input. This underlines the necessity of confirming the application’s enabled status as a primary troubleshooting step.
Further analysis reveals that the “Keyboard App Enabled” status can be influenced by several factors. System updates, third-party applications with system-level permissions, or user-initiated modifications to accessibility settings can all inadvertently disable the selected keyboard. The operating system, in its routine functions, can also introduce modifications to keyboard settings requiring the user to re-enable the input method. A practical application of this understanding lies in regularly verifying the enabled status of the keyboard application, particularly after significant system or application updates, to preempt potential input disruptions. It may also be necessary to clear cache or restart the device to fully reset keyboard functions.
In summary, the functionality of the on-screen typing interface hinges significantly on ensuring the selected keyboard application is actively enabled within the Android system settings. Failing to recognize this fundamental element can lead to unnecessary troubleshooting efforts focused on secondary factors. While other potential causes may exist, verifying the “Keyboard App Enabled” status serves as a crucial initial step in diagnosing and resolving instances where the typing interface does not appear.
3. Software Glitches
Software glitches, unpredictable anomalies arising from programming errors or unforeseen conflicts within the operating system, represent a potential cause for the absence of the on-screen typing interface on Android devices. These transient errors can disrupt the normal function of system services responsible for rendering and managing the keyboard, leading to its unexpected disappearance.
-
Temporary Service Interruptions
Software glitches can temporarily interrupt the services responsible for rendering the on-screen keyboard. These interruptions might be brief, causing the keyboard to disappear sporadically or after specific actions. For example, a background process consuming excessive resources may temporarily starve the keyboard service, preventing it from launching when a text field is selected. The implication is that the keyboard’s absence is not due to a permanent configuration error but rather a transient system overload.
-
Corrupted Cache Data
The keyboard application, like other software, relies on cached data for efficient operation. Software glitches can corrupt this cached data, leading to errors in the keyboard’s rendering process. This might manifest as the keyboard failing to load or displaying incorrectly. As an example, corrupted font data within the keyboard’s cache could prevent the characters from displaying, effectively rendering the keyboard unusable. This corrupted data can cause the keyboard to not properly be displayed at the time needed.
-
Conflict with Other Applications
Software glitches can create conflicts between the keyboard application and other installed applications. These conflicts might arise due to shared resources or incompatible code. For instance, a newly installed application with aggressive resource management may interfere with the keyboard’s ability to access necessary system functions, resulting in its failure to appear. This necessitates a process of elimination to identify the conflicting application.
-
Operating System Instability
Underlying instability within the Android operating system itself, often caused by unresolved bugs or incomplete updates, can manifest as software glitches affecting various system services, including keyboard functionality. These glitches may lead to the keyboard failing to load consistently or experiencing random crashes. For example, an operating system update with known memory leaks could gradually degrade system performance, eventually impacting the keyboard’s stability. The implication is that resolving the keyboard issue may require addressing underlying operating system problems.
The aforementioned facets collectively illustrate how software glitches can disrupt the reliable function of the on-screen keyboard on Android devices. These transient errors, ranging from temporary service interruptions to conflicts with other applications, highlight the complexity of software interactions and the potential for unforeseen problems to affect seemingly fundamental device functions. Addressing these glitches requires systematic troubleshooting to identify and resolve the underlying software issues, which often involves clearing caches, identifying conflicting applications, or updating the operating system.
4. Settings Configuration
Incorrect or unintended alterations to the Android device’s settings represent a significant contributor to the on-screen keyboard failing to appear. The operating system’s configuration options govern numerous device functionalities, and modifications within these settings can directly impact the keyboard’s availability and behavior.
-
Input Method Selection
Android allows users to select their preferred input method. If no keyboard is selected or if a non-functional input method is designated as the default, the on-screen keyboard will not appear. For example, if a user inadvertently deselects all keyboards under “Current Keyboard” or selects a corrupted custom keyboard, the system lacks a valid input source, preventing the keyboard from launching in text fields. This highlights the necessity of verifying the presence of an active and functional input method within the system settings.
-
Hardware Keyboard Detection
Android devices can detect connected physical keyboards. If the system incorrectly identifies a physical keyboard as being connected, the on-screen keyboard may be suppressed under the assumption that a physical input device is available. A user working on a tablet might experience this issue if a Bluetooth keyboard pairing is remembered but the keyboard is not physically present or powered on. The system setting governing hardware keyboard detection, if improperly configured, will lead to the on-screen keyboards absence. This suppression of the on-screen keyboard based on hardware keyboard detection requires meticulous review of associated settings.
-
Auto-Capitalization and Predictive Text
Although seemingly unrelated, settings controlling auto-capitalization and predictive text can indirectly impact keyboard visibility. Corrupted settings related to these features may trigger software glitches that prevent the keyboard from loading correctly. For example, a malfunctioning auto-correction algorithm might cause the keyboard service to crash, temporarily rendering the input method unavailable. Even seemingly minor input settings, when corrupted, can create keyboard appearance issues. The reliability of input settings is therefore crucial.
-
Accessibility Settings
Certain accessibility settings designed to aid users with disabilities can also interfere with the standard on-screen keyboard. For instance, enabling specific gesture navigation options or alternative input methods might inadvertently disable the default keyboard or conflict with its rendering process. Individuals who have enabled accessibility features may find the standard keyboard replaced by a different interface or completely suppressed. Assessing and adjusting accessibility settings can thus be necessary to restore standard keyboard functionality.
These configuration elements underscore the importance of reviewing and adjusting Android settings when the on-screen keyboard fails to appear. The operating system’s configuration controls influence keyboard behavior, highlighting the need for careful attention to these settings during troubleshooting. Adjusting settings can restore keyboard operation and address various root causes for the absence of the on-screen keyboard.
5. System Updates
System updates, designed to enhance device performance and security, can paradoxically contribute to the issue of the on-screen typing interface failing to appear. While updates typically include bug fixes and improvements to system stability, the installation process or underlying changes introduced within the update can sometimes introduce unforeseen conflicts or software regressions that affect keyboard functionality. For example, an update intended to optimize battery usage might inadvertently alter system resource allocation, leading to insufficient resources for the keyboard service to initialize properly. This can manifest as the keyboard failing to load when a text field is selected, directly impacting the user’s ability to input information.
The correlation between system updates and keyboard malfunction often stems from incomplete or corrupted update installations. Interruptions during the update process, such as power outages or network connectivity issues, can result in partially installed software components. These incomplete installations may lead to inconsistencies within the operating system that affect the keyboard’s operation. Furthermore, compatibility issues between the updated operating system and specific keyboard applications or system libraries can also cause keyboard failures. The complexity of software interactions increases the likelihood of these adverse effects following a system update. For instance, older devices with limited resources might struggle to adapt to the demands of a newer operating system version, leading to various performance issues, including keyboard unresponsiveness. Practical mitigation strategies involve ensuring stable power and network connections during updates and verifying application compatibility post-update.
In conclusion, while system updates are generally beneficial, they carry a risk of introducing unforeseen complications that can manifest as a non-functional on-screen keyboard. Understanding the potential for update-related issues is crucial for effective troubleshooting. Prioritizing stable update environments and verifying post-update functionality can help mitigate these risks. Addressing such problems may involve rolling back updates or seeking specific patches from device manufacturers to restore proper keyboard operation. System updates, while necessary for device maintenance, necessitate careful monitoring to prevent unintended consequences affecting fundamental device functionality.
6. Permissions Granted
The functionality of the on-screen keyboard on Android devices is contingent upon the requisite permissions granted to the keyboard application. The absence of these permissions can directly prevent the keyboard from appearing, irrespective of its enabled status or system settings. The Android operating system employs a permission model to regulate application access to sensitive resources and functionalities. Keyboard applications, like others, require specific permissions to access system services necessary for rendering the keyboard interface, processing input, and accessing personal dictionaries. If these permissions are denied, the keyboard application may be unable to perform its intended functions, resulting in its failure to appear when needed. A specific scenario involves a keyboard application lacking permission to “Read Contacts,” preventing it from suggesting contact names during typing. Without this permission, the predictive text functionality may fail, or, in some cases, the entire keyboard application might not load to protect user data integrity.
Insufficiently granted permissions can stem from various factors. The user may have inadvertently denied necessary permissions during the initial application setup or later through the device’s settings. Furthermore, updates to the Android operating system or the keyboard application itself can sometimes reset or modify permission settings, necessitating user re-authorization. The impact of denied permissions extends beyond mere functionality limitations. It can create security vulnerabilities if the keyboard application attempts to operate without proper authorization or lead to unexpected crashes and instability. Practical implications of understanding this connection include routinely reviewing application permissions, particularly after updates or when encountering keyboard-related issues. Checking and adjusting permissions through the Android settings menu ensures the keyboard application has the access required to operate correctly.
In summary, the “Permissions Granted” component plays a vital role in the proper functioning of the on-screen typing interface on Android. Insufficiently or incorrectly granted permissions can directly prevent the keyboard from appearing, leading to frustration and impaired device usability. Regularly verifying and managing application permissions through the device’s settings is a crucial step in troubleshooting keyboard issues and ensuring a seamless user experience. Recognizing the cause-and-effect relationship between permissions and keyboard functionality empowers users to proactively address potential problems and maintain optimal device performance.
7. Hardware Conflicts
Hardware conflicts, while less frequent than software-related issues, represent a potential cause for the absence of the on-screen keyboard on Android devices. These conflicts arise when the operating system incorrectly detects or prioritizes a physical keyboard over the virtual one, or when other connected hardware components interfere with the input process. The consequence is the suppression of the virtual keyboard, rendering text input impossible. For instance, a faulty Bluetooth connection with a keyboard that is not actively in use can signal to the Android system that a hardware keyboard is present, leading to the on-screen keyboard’s disappearance. The presence of incompatible USB devices can also disrupt system processes, affecting keyboard functionality, particularly in devices supporting USB-OTG (On-The-Go). The occurrence of hardware conflicts directly undermines the users ability to interact with the device.
The system’s interpretation of hardware input takes precedence, which necessitates considering connected peripherals when troubleshooting keyboard problems. It is essential to disconnect any external keyboards, mice, or other input devices to ascertain whether the conflict is originating from one of these sources. In cases involving persistent hardware conflicts, examining the device’s hardware settings for manual override options may be necessary. Furthermore, devices with damaged or malfunctioning sensors can transmit erroneous signals to the operating system, causing it to misinterpret the available input methods. For example, a damaged proximity sensor could interfere with keyboard display logic. It may require initiating hardware diagnostic tests.
Addressing hardware conflicts requires systematic isolation of potential sources and a thorough evaluation of the devices input settings and connected peripherals. Recognizing the potential for hardware interference in the absence of the virtual keyboard enables users to eliminate contributing factors and restore normal input functionality. The elimination process is a logical step to be taken in cases of keyboard malfunctioning to check if it is linked with existing hardware functionality.
Frequently Asked Questions
The following addresses frequently encountered questions concerning the non-appearance of the on-screen keyboard on Android devices. It provides information to clarify potential causes and diagnostic approaches.
Question 1: Why does the keyboard sometimes fail to appear after updating the operating system?
System updates, while designed to improve performance, can introduce compatibility issues with existing keyboard applications. These issues can prevent the keyboard from loading correctly. Checking for keyboard application updates or rolling back the operating system update may resolve the problem.
Question 2: How does application compatibility affect the visibility of the keyboard?
Some applications are not fully compatible with all keyboard implementations. This incompatibility can prevent the keyboard from appearing within the specific application. Testing the keyboard in other applications can help determine if the issue is application-specific.
Question 3: Is a disabled keyboard application the sole reason for its absence?
A disabled keyboard application is a primary reason, but other factors, such as system glitches, incorrect settings, and conflicting applications, can also contribute. A comprehensive approach to troubleshooting is recommended.
Question 4: How do hardware conflicts impact the on-screen keyboard’s functionality?
Hardware conflicts, particularly with external keyboards or input devices, can cause the system to suppress the on-screen keyboard. Disconnecting external devices can help identify if a hardware conflict is the source of the issue.
Question 5: Can incorrect settings configurations prevent the keyboard from appearing?
Yes. Incorrect settings, such as disabled input methods or incorrect hardware keyboard detection, can prevent the keyboard from appearing. Reviewing and adjusting these settings may resolve the problem.
Question 6: Are application permissions necessary for the keyboard to function correctly?
Yes. Keyboard applications require specific permissions to access system services. Denied permissions can prevent the keyboard from functioning correctly. Ensuring that the necessary permissions are granted is crucial.
These frequently asked questions address common concerns surrounding the lack of on-screen keyboard visibility on Android devices. Considering each of these points can streamline the troubleshooting process.
The subsequent section will focus on detailed troubleshooting methods to resolve the “keyboard not showing on android” problem.
Troubleshooting Tips
The following recommendations provide structured approaches for addressing instances where the on-screen keyboard fails to appear on Android devices. These tips emphasize systematic diagnosis and resolution.
Tip 1: Verify Keyboard Application Enablement Confirm that the desired keyboard application is enabled in the device’s settings. A disabled keyboard prevents system-wide access to the input method. Navigate to “Settings > System > Languages & input > Virtual keyboard” to verify the application’s active status.
Tip 2: Restart the Device A device restart can resolve transient software glitches interfering with keyboard functionality. This action clears system memory and restarts running services, potentially restoring the keyboard’s operation.
Tip 3: Clear Keyboard Application Cache Corrupted cache data can cause keyboard applications to malfunction. Clearing the cache can resolve these issues. Access “Settings > Apps > [Keyboard Application Name] > Storage > Clear Cache”.
Tip 4: Check for Application Conflicts Newly installed applications can conflict with existing system processes, including keyboard operation. Temporarily uninstall recently added applications to determine if they are the source of the issue.
Tip 5: Ensure Correct Input Method Selection Verify that the correct input method is selected in the device’s settings. An incorrect selection, or the absence of a selected method, can prevent the keyboard from appearing. Access “Settings > System > Languages & input > Current keyboard” and ensure a valid keyboard is selected.
Tip 6: Disconnect External Devices Connected external keyboards or input devices can suppress the on-screen keyboard. Disconnect all peripherals and assess whether the virtual keyboard appears. This action isolates potential hardware conflicts.
Tip 7: Review Application Permissions Keyboard applications require specific permissions to function correctly. Ensure that the necessary permissions are granted to the keyboard application via “Settings > Apps > [Keyboard Application Name] > Permissions”.
Tip 8: Update the Operating System An outdated operating system can contain bugs that affect keyboard functionality. Install any available system updates to resolve potential software issues that can contribute to the non-appearance of the on-screen keyboard.
These troubleshooting tips offer a systematic approach for addressing instances where the on-screen keyboard fails to appear on Android devices. Adhering to these steps can facilitate efficient diagnosis and resolution, ensuring continued device usability.
The subsequent section will conclude this discussion, summarizing key insights and emphasizing the importance of proactive device maintenance.
Conclusion
The preceding analysis has comprehensively addressed the issue of “keyboard not showing on android,” examining potential causes ranging from application incompatibility and disabled settings to system glitches and hardware conflicts. Effective resolution necessitates a systematic approach involving verification of keyboard settings, cache management, conflict identification, and permission review. System updates and hardware isolation further contribute to restoring keyboard functionality. These methodologies constitute a robust framework for diagnosing and rectifying instances of keyboard absence on Android devices.
Consistent application of these troubleshooting strategies ensures sustained device usability. Periodic review of settings and proactive system maintenance, including timely updates and permission audits, remains crucial for preventing future disruptions. Maintaining a vigilant approach to device management is paramount for optimizing performance and averting unforeseen complications that may impede fundamental input capabilities.